在CentOS系統中,回收備份文件通常涉及到刪除不再需要的備份文件以釋放存儲空間。以下是一些常見的方法來回收備份文件:
手動刪除:
rm
)手動刪除不再需要的備份文件。rm /path/to/backup/file1.bak
rm -r /path/to/backup/directory1
rm /path/to/backup/*.bak
使用定時任務:
cron
定時任務來自動化這個過程。crontab
文件:crontab -e
0 2 * * * find /path/to/backup -type f -name "*.bak" -mtime +7 -exec rm {} \;
使用腳本:
cleanup_backups.sh
的腳本:#!/bin/bash
find /path/to/backup -type f -name "*.bak" -mtime +7 -exec rm {} \;
chmod +x /path/to/cleanup_backups.sh
crontab
中:0 2 * * * /path/to/cleanup_backups.sh
使用存儲管理工具:
rsync
、tar
等。監控存儲空間:
df
、du
)定期檢查存儲空間的使用情況,并根據需要清理備份文件。df -h
du -sh /path/to/backup
通過以上方法,你可以有效地回收和管理CentOS系統中的備份文件,確保系統的存儲空間得到合理利用。